SUMMARY:Handwork 2026 - The Ergonomic Efficiency of English Style Knitting (“Throwing”)
DESCRIPTION:This program is part of Handwork 2026\, presented by Craft in America \nMany knitters avoid knitting in the English style (a.k.a. “British” or “throwing”) or even switch to another style because they think it can’t be efficient. The truth is\, it’s a very efficient method\, but it’s being done wrong by most of us in the 21st century. \nLearn how to comfortably knit using this technique with ease from author\, life-long knitter and former physical therapist Carson Demers. \nThis class is a deep dive into the original techniques and landmarks of English knitting\, what we’ve done to make it seem inefficient and slow\, and how to undo or modify those faulty variations. \nKnitters will learn to knit more efficiently and more comfortably with this class. \nBeginners are welcome but this is not a learn-to-knit class for first timers. Knitters must be able to independently cast-on\, and make knit and purl stitches in the English style. \nNote that there is homework before the workshop. Students are asked to use light colored worsted weight yarn to cast on 30 stitches (any technique) and work as follows: \n\nRows 1-6: Knit all stitches (garter stitch).\nRow 7 (WS): Knit 2. Purl 26 st. Knit 2 st.\nRow 8 (RS): Knit all stitches.\nRepeat Rows 7 and 8 until sample measures 4-inches (10.6 cm)\nDo NOT bind off. SUMMARY:Handwork 2026 - Will This Yarn Hurt My Hands? The Ergonomics and Mechanics of Yarn
DESCRIPTION:This program is part of Handwork 2026\, presented by Craft in America \nThis class is appropriate for knitters and crocheters\, spinners\, and any crafter who uses yarn. \nCreating or embellishing fabric is an exercise in energy exchange between your body and the yarn. \nSome yarns will help with this exchange while others are ‘energy vampires’ that require you to give your all! \nIn this class\, you’ll “dissect” a variety of yarns to understand how helpful it will be in sharing the work. \nWe’ll go far beyond what some think is obvious (cotton is “harder” to knit than wool) and dive deeply into the characteristics of plant and animal fibers\, fiber\, yarn structure and construction and how it relates to fiber artists’ hand comfort. \nSpinners will learn how to make a yarn that will be comfortable for them and others to work with. \nUnderstanding the mechanics\, fiber and construction of yarns will help you to select and make yarns that will be comfortable for your hands and arms to work with. You’ll learn how to make a more challenging yarn a comfortable one. \nYarn will be provided. \nStudents joining us for this workshop receive free admission to Carson’s lecture\, Knitting Sustainably. You will receive details on how to register for the lecture with free admission upon signing up for this workshop.

SUMMARY:PEI Fibre Festival 2026 - What’s the Point of Your Needle – The Ergonomics of Knitting Needles
DESCRIPTION:By the end of the class\, you’ll have a new understanding of how needle design influences your knitting and comfort. You’ll gain the knowledge and confidence to choose the best needle for each project—making your knitting more comfortable\, efficient\, and enjoyable. \nDuration: 6 hours (one hour for lunch) | Capacity: 25\nLocation: Level 1 – Summerside Room \n\n\nA knitting needle is not just a needle. The needle you choose can have a major impact on how comfortable\, efficient\, and enjoyable your knitting experience is. Yet many of us simply reach for whatever needle size the pattern recommends—or whichever needle happens to be available—without considering how the needle’s design interacts with the yarn and stitch pattern. \nModern knitting needles come in a wide range of materials\, tip shapes\, shaft finishes\, cable styles\, and flexibility\, all of which influence how stitches form and move on the needle. When the needle and yarn are well matched\, knitting can feel smooth\, effortless\, and rhythmic. When they aren’t\, you may find yourself struggling with tight stitches\, hand fatigue\, slower progress\, or even eye strain and physical discomfort. \nIn this hands-on class\, you’ll explore how different needle features affect your knitting through guided experimentation with a variety of needles\, yarns\, and stitch patterns. By trying different combinations\, you’ll experience firsthand how dramatically the right needle can improve comfort\, stitch control\, and knitting efficiency. \nParticipants will learn how to:\n\nIdentify key needle features such as tip shape\, material\, surface finish\, and flexibility\nUnderstand how different needles interact with yarn types and stitch patterns\nRecognize when a needle choice may be contributing to fatigue or frustration\nSelect needles that support better ergonomics\, smoother knitting\, and greater enjoyment

SUMMARY:PEI Fibre Festival 2026 - The Ergonomic Efficiency of English Style Knitting
DESCRIPTION:If you have been unhappy with the efficiency and productivity of your English style knitting\, this will help you improve both through discovery of how very efficient this method is intended to be. The goal of this class is to enhance your existing technique rather than learn a new style of knitting. For best outcome of all participants\, this workshop is suited to existing knitters. It is not intended to teach you how to knit but how to knit more efficiently. \nSkill Expectations for this Workshop: \n– Basic knitting skills: knit/purl\, cast on/bind off\, increase/decrease \nDuration: 3 hours | Capacity: 20\nLocation: Level 1 – Summerside Room \n\n\nMany knitters avoid the English style of knitting (often called “British” or “throwing”) because they believe it’s slow or inefficient. Some even abandon it entirely in favour of other methods. But the truth is that English knitting can be highly efficient and comfortable—when it’s done the way it was originally intended. \nIn this class\, we’ll take a deep dive into the traditional mechanics and key hand positions of English knitting. Over time\, small changes in how the method is commonly taught and demonstrated have made it appear slower and more effortful than it actually needs to be. By exploring the original movement patterns and structural landmarks of the technique\, you’ll see how English knitting was designed to work smoothly and efficiently. This class will teach you a technique reminiscent of traditional Shetland knitting minus the belt. \nThrough demonstration and guided practice\, knitters will learn how to:\n\nIdentify common habits that make English knitting slower or more tiring\nUnderstand the original hand positions and yarn movements used in traditional English knitting\nModify or correct inefficient variations that have developed over time\nImprove speed\, rhythm\, and comfort while maintaining the English style
